**Handover Note — Directors Ines Falwick to Torben Grale**

For the board of Ashvane Components: the Pellbrook factory capacity decision remains open. Demand forecasts support a second shift rather than a new line, but tooling lead times argue otherwise. Torben should review supplier terms before deciding. Context for this choice appears in the confidential note below.

management briefing: Only 7 of the 80 pilot accounts renewed Ralath, so a churn review is set for July 1.

**Q: My plugin hammers the Brambleware GraphQL API with N+1 queries — what changed?**

A: We shipped batching via the new dataloader layer, so nested resolvers now coalesce automatically. Just upgrade to SDK v4 and delete any manual caching hacks. Upgrading re-keys your plugin credentials, and the migration tool will ask you to confirm with the recovery passphrase listed below.

unlock words, yagep-kajop: casix-oliix-novdor-fraael-kasdor-eliael

Before we tag this release, I want to flag that the new driver-assignment heuristic in Routewell's dispatch core weights proximity more aggressively than the old greedy matcher did. Marisol and I verified that idle-time penalties no longer starve drivers in low-density zones, but the decay factor interacts subtly with the surge multiplier, so please don't adjust one without the other. For traceability, the current shipped values are listed below.

tuning table, faweg-bajep:
WEIGHTS = {
    "belius": 690,
    "eliox": 458,
    "norax": 616,
    "praion": 132,
    "zorvan": 911,
}

Subject: DR drill Thursday — LockerLine access flow

Release manager: DR drill runs Thursday 09:00. We'll fail over the LockerLine laundry-locker access flow to the Brenholt standby cluster. Expect the door-release API to go read-only for ten minutes. Hold any deploys until the all-clear. If the admin console locks you out mid-drill, use the recovery passphrase noted directly below this line.

unlock words, hahip-baduf: holwyn-istath-julvan